Why does my dog need routine grooming?

Frequent grooming of your pet doesn’t just keeps your dog’s hair looking fantastic, but it also helps maintain your dog’s fur and physical health and wellbeing. When your dog gets groomed, it prevents painful matting and knots in their fur, eliminates the growth of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thedog away from pests such as bugs. During your pet’s grooming appointment, your Calca pet groomer will look out for lumps and sores that could progress into a health problem.


How frequently should my pet get groomed?

Grooming needs for your pet will vary depending on the breed, hair and your dog’s habits. Some pets only need sporadic bath, brush and nail trim whilst other dog breeds may require more frequent brushing or even concentrated brushing during their season change of coat.. Commonly, most pet parents book frequent grooming about once a month. For pups and dogs who have not been groomed yet, more frequent grooming at home should be performed to get the dog used to being handled and to prevent grooming issues as they grow up. What’s the difference between a pet bathing and grooming service?

Dog bathing services consist of: 1-3 cycles of shampoo, 1 cycle of conditioner, hand-dry as permitted by dog, brush and/or combing.

Pet grooming consist of: Everything included above in bathing plus a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your specific requests, nails cut, and ears cleaned.

What is chalking in dog grooming?

Chalking the coat on man’s best friend is a procedure utilized prior to handstripping to allow for a better grip on the fur. The very same principle is applied when drawing the hair from the ear canal. Chalking is also used in the conformation ring to boost the hair color and to give the coat far more smoothness and volume.

What is good for a canines scratchy skin?

Chamomile, calendula, and green tea have traits that relieve and cool irritated skin. These soaks are good for dogs who have hot, scratchy patches of skin that are at risk of becoming rubbed raw.

Can you over brush your pet?

While pet dogs cannot be over-brushed, improper brushing techniques and tools might trigger your pup some excessive pain. To prevent hurting your pet dog, mild and slow brushing works best. Also, make certain to take breaks to provide her a rest along with to applaud and treat your client pup.



How do you groom a dog with scissors?

Beginning at the top of your canine’s head, comb any fur forward and up out of your canine’s eyes. Trim with scissors to any length you ‘d like. Use short blade scissors to cut around your pet’s eyes and for his beard. Place your fingers at the tip of your pet dog’s ear to prevent cutting the skin.
